Abstract

Maharashtra is one of the 28 states in India and area wise it is the second largest state. Geographically Maharashatra extends from latitude 15°44' N to 22°6" N and longitude 72°36' E to 80°44' E and triangular in shape which occupies 9.36% land of India. Maharashtra has 36 districts in which Pune district is one of the important district. The present study region (Vel basin) totally occupied in this district. Pune district 100% drained by Bhima river basin. Bhima is the main river in this district and it has many tributaries like Pushpavati, Aar, Meena, Ghod, Vel, Bhama, Indrayani, Pavana, Mula-Mutha, Valaki, Gunjavani. Nira, Karha, and Sudha etc. The main characteristic of Vel River is that it is Plateau River.
